Part VI (para. 13-14) The problem is solved and they were reconnected again. Pressured and Stressed Students In order to maintain focus on your college work, it is i
9、mportant to keep stress levels low. Reducing your stress level in college will ultimately improve your power of concentration, your work level and your marks. Lets face it. There are lots of things to get stressed about when youre in college, from earning good grades to co-existing with your roommat
10、es, or getting accepted to a sports team, a society for students, or other organizations. Every aspect of life is a potential source of stress. Its all about keeping it managed and under control, or taking different approaches to dealing with certain issues. Whats the relation between stress and med
11、ical problems? Have you ever heard someone saying: “Its all in your mind.”? The effects of stress often lead to some mental problems. It is also a fact that continuous high levels of stress can be harmful to your body, not just your mind. Continuous high stress levels lead to things like headaches,
12、high blood pressure, and ultimately also to physical complaints like kidney problems. If you suffer from constant stress, you should consult a medical doctor about your situation. Physicians can advise you on how to reduce your stress levels or help you with medicines. If you are likely to get highl
13、y stressed or if you have a stress-related illness, medicine is important to keep the stress level low and to avoid other stress-related diseases or symptoms. Taking your medication will not only help you reduce the stress level, but also help protect your body from developing physical side effects.
14、 Even though you are usually young when attending college, you should consider comprehensive health care coverage; this also contributes to peace of mind. What are the strategies to reduce stress? There is an old saying that claims “A problem shared is a problem halved.” Just by talking to someone w
15、ith a sympathetic ear, you may discover that whatever is bothering you is half as bad. As a college student, youll have contact with academic tutors for any student problems, counselors for personal and financial issues, and your friends and roommates for everything imaginable. And if living on camp
16、us or student life in general is stressing you out, then leave university and stay at home for a few days. The next two ways to reduce stress seem to contradict each other, but depending on your personality, one of them may work well for you. If youre a bit of a party animal and if you are on the wa
17、y all the time, take a rest. Slow down the pace of your life and spend a few quiet nights recharging your batteries. The alternative, if youre more reserved, is to gather with a few friends and go out and have some fun. Whatever you do, try to avoid these common problems most students experience. St
18、ress is often related with eating disturbance because if you are stressed, you either eat nothing or eat too much and above all unhealthy things like fast food. Eating too much could result in becoming overweight, and an earlier claim on your life insurance policy! So, if youre eating too much junk
19、food, change your diet to include more fruit and vegetables. And if you do not have a regular sleeping pattern, develop some regular sleeping hours. Finally, even if youre not the sporty type, get some exercise and fresh air. Just a daily 30-minute walk outdoors will improve your blood circulation a
20、nd help you clear your head. Youll feel refreshed and ready to start again. Being a college student is all about earning a qualification that will help you develop your interests and pursue them down a chosen career path. It should be something that you can enjoy and look forward to on a daily basis
21、, not something that you dread. No one wants to be stressed, but if you are stressed, there are people you can talk to, and who will help you overcome whatever your difficulty is.pressure: vt. 对对施加压力;迫使施加压力;迫使我们中的许多人都想要,甚至感到有这样的压力,要在我们做的每件事情上都获得成功。e.g. - Children are often pressured into studying ve
